Position Details:

We are seeking a friendly and compassionate PCP Nurse Practitioner to join our team. As a PCP Nurse Practitioner, you will play a crucial role in providing comprehensive care to patients in long-term care facilities. This is an exciting opportunity to make a difference in the lives of patients while working alongside a dedicated team of healthcare professionals.

Responsibilities:

Provide comprehensive healthcare services and coordinate patient care
Work closely with a team of healthcare professionals
Assess, diagnose, and treat residents' physical and mental well-being
Conduct thorough patient assessments, including medical history reviews and physical examinations
Order and interpret diagnostic tests
Develop accurate diagnoses and treatment plans
Prescribe medications and administer treatments
Provide counseling to residents and their families
Collaborate with the interdisciplinary team for seamless coordination of care
Manage chronic conditions and monitor progress
Make appropriate adjustments to care plans
Commitment to person-centered care
Create a safe and nurturing environment for elderly residents in the nursing home.
